About the Chandreshwar

Chandreshwar is a serene destination in Uttar Pradesh, known for its rich cultural heritage and picturesque landscapes. Visitors can explore ancient temples, lush green fields, and experience the warmth of local hospitality.

Best Time to Visit

October to March

Trip Duration

3-4 days

A longer stay allows for a deeper exploration of the region.

How to Reach Chandreshwar

✈️

Air

The nearest airport is in Lucknow, approximately 150 km away.;

🚌

Bus

Regular bus services connect Chandreshwar with nearby towns.

🚆

Train

Chandreshwar is accessible by train from major cities in Uttar Pradesh.
